Für Leute die gerne helfen! Ideen sind gefragt.

BigFacker

Erfahrenes Mitglied
Büdde bis zum ENDE lesen;) DANKE!

Ok hallo. Vielleicht sollte ich mal ein wenig ausholen damit ihr das auch alle versteht;)

ok, ich möchte auf meiner LAN-Service Page folgendes Feature einbauen:
Wir haben einen Sitzplan der aus verschiedenen kleineren Bildern zusammengebastelt ist. Nun möchte ich, das wenn ich über ein Sitz fahre, das in einem kleinen Fensterchen gezeigt wird, wer sich für dieses Fenster angemeldet hat. Soweit alles kein Problem und mit DHTML ziemlich leicht zu realisieren: Das Problem: Alle Eintragung sollen automatisch verarbeitet werden, so das ich im Endeffekt keine Arbeit habe.

So hab ich das ganze angefangen, und irgendwie muss es auch so weitergehen:):

1. Ich habe eine Datei, in der die Sitzplätze gespeichert sind. Jedem Sitzplatz ist eine User zugeordnet, sofern der Sitz besetzt ist. Die Sitzplätze sind alle variablen.

2. Nun habe ich das DHTML (also JAVAScript Script:)) und dort will ich die Datei mit den Sitzzuweisungen importieren, was aber wie ich in dem Thread drüber und in diversen JavaForen erfahren habe, nicht möglich ist.

Die Frage ist nun: Wie kann man das ganze realisieren. Ich habe keine Ideen mehr! Da man wie gesagt in das JS keine Datei einfügen kann, die die nötigen Variablen beinhaltet hätte.

Wenn ihr euch das ganze mal angucken wollt: http://www.lan-utopia.de/index.php?show=sitzplan

Die roten Sietz sind belegt, soweit hab ichs allein hinbekommen:)

Ok, wäre echt fett wenn hier irgendjemand ne Idee hat...
 
Alles was gemacht werden muß ist auch das j-script dynamisch (bzw. teile davon) zu machen. dein php-backend sollte nicht nur die variablen rausrücken, sondern auch das j-script so an die page übergeben, das die variablen kein problem mehr darstellen.

etwas anderes: mach diesen sch**** pseudo-quelltextschutz weg. 1.bringt es nix und 2. schränkt es deine besucher ein. denn nicht nur quelltext wird gesperrt, sondern auch zurück, vorwärt, drucken, eigenschaften, etc. werden unterdrückt... und drittens hasse ich es meine alternativen browser extra starten zu müssen.

:)

es gibt übrigens einen php-kalender, der dhtml für eine ähnliche funktion benutzt. die termine werden angezeigt, wenn du mit der maus über die tage fährst. wenn interesse besteht, kann ich dir das ding zuschicken.
 
Hi ich hab mir auch grad mal die Seite angekuckt und muss dir leider sagen das deine Homepage für Opera noch nicht fit ist: das rechte menü ist viel weiter Rechts als du es wahrscheinlich haben willst...

tob
 
mach doch in einer Datenbank 2 Spalten. Eine ist Sitzplatznummer und die andere ist Status. Beim Status hast du 1 für frei, 2 für reserviert und 3 für bezahlt (muss aber nicht unbedingt grad so sein :) ) und die Sitzplatznummern sind halt einfach die Sitzplatznummern.

Dann checkst du bei jedem Bild die dazugehörige Sitzplatznummer ab und bei 1 zeigt er ein grünes Quadrat an, bei 2 ein gelbes und bei 3 ein rotes (oder wie du willst).

Bei der Reservation setzt man den Status des gewünschten Platzes auf 2 und du kannst ihn in einem Adminbereich auf 3 stellen, sobald bezahlt wurde.


Ich hoffe, du hast meine Idee verstanden.



PS: kannst ja noch 'ne 3. Spalte machen, in welcher drinsteht, wer den Platz reserviert hat.
 
ich hoffe ich hab dich richtig verstanden....

schreib dir doch einmal den sitzplan als html + jscript und dann ersetzt du imma das was in dem kleinen fensterchen angezeigt wird mit variablen statt der reingeschrieben sachen aus der html datei...
-> wenn ich jetzt irgendwas verplant hab, sorry, aba schule haut rein :-)
 
Also ich habs folgender Maßen jetzt gemacht: Ich hab halt die Datei mit den Sitzplätzen. So und jeder Sitzplatz steht in einer If schleife. Die If schleife besagt, das der Sitz nur grau erscheinen soll, wenn in der Datei reservirung.dat nicht der String das Sitzplatzes enthalten ist. Also hab ichs so gemacht, das bei jeder Anmeldung, der Sitzplatzstring, der halt überprüft wird, in die Datei reservierung.dat geschrieben wird. Also quasie wies vorgeschlagen wurde nicht mit Datenbanken, sondern mit Textfiles. Kommt aber aufs gleiche raus.

Jope, das mit dem Opra hat mir auch schon einer gesagt, aber da kann ich im moment nets dran ändern. Mich kotzt diese ganze verschiedene Enterpretierung von irgendwelchen Quellcode, diverser browser sowieso an.

Vielen Dank für eure tips!
 
Zurück